Lead Mechanical Technician – Critical / Mission-Critical Environment The Opportunity We are seeking an experienced Lead Mechanical Technician to join a high-performing engineering team within a critical or mission-critical environment.
This is a hands-on leadership role combining technical delivery with team supervision. You will work across complex mechanical and building services systems, playing a key role in ensuring safety, compliance, and operational reliability while supporting site leadership and mentoring engineering staff.
Role Overview As a Lead Mechanical Technician, you will oversee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M), reactive maintenance, and minor project works across critical mechanical infrastructure.
Acting as Deputy to the Technical Services Supervisor (TSS) when required, you will coordinate engineering activities, supervise subcontractors, and ensure all work is completed to the highest technical and safety standards.

- Act as Deputy to the Technical Services Supervisor (TSS) when required
- Participate in emergency escalation procedures and provide out-of-hours technical support
- Promote a strong culture of Health & Safety, professionalism, and technical excellence
- Ensure compliance with Safe Systems of Work, including RAMS, LOTO, and Permit to Work (PTW) procedures
- Operate as Authorised Person (AP) where appointed
- Oversee and carry out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M), reactive, and emergency maintenance on mechanical systems
- Diagnose and resolve faults to minimise downtime and operational disruption
- Coordinate maintenance activities via Helpdesk / CMMS systems and site stakeholders
- Ensure all work meets engineering standards, statutory requirements, and industry best practice
- Support minor projects, plant upgrades, and asset replacement programmes
- Allocate resources and prioritise workloads to meet SLAs and operational demands
- Supervise and mentor technicians and apprentices, supporting ongoing development
- Build strong working relationships with clients, contractors, and internal engineering teams
- Promote a culture of teamwork, accountability, and continuous improvement
- Provide regular updates to the Technical Services Supervisor, highlighting operational risks and performance issues
- Accurately record maintenance activities within CMMS / CAFM systems
- Ensure compliance with statutory regulations, site procedures, and engineering standards
- Maintain training records and support ongoing technical competency across the team
- NVQ Level 3 (or equivalent) in Mechanical Engineering or Building Services
- Minimum 5 years’ experience within mechanical maintenance environments
- Experience within critical environments, data centres, or high-availability facilities (desirable)
- Proven experience supervising teams and coordinating maintenance activities
- Strong fault-finding and diagnostic capability across mechanical and HVAC systems
- Good understanding of statutory compliance, engineering standards, and Safe Systems of Work
- Experience using CMMS / CAFM systems and Microsoft Office applications
- Strong leadership and team management skills
- Excellent problem-solving and decision-making ability
- Effective communication and stakeholder engagement skills
- Self-motivated, organised, and capable of managing competing priorities
- Strong commitment to Health & Safety and operational excellence
- Authorised Person (AP) certification
- Experience within mission-critical or high-risk environments
- Additional Health & Safety or technical certifications
- Work within a critical, high-performance engineering environment
- Combine hands-on engineering with leadership responsibilities
- Clear progression into supervisory or management roles
- Access ongoing training and professional development
- Join a collaborative, safety-focused engineering team
